Child Abduction and Custody Act 1985

21 Reports.U.K.

Where the Lord Chancellor[F1, the Department of Justice in Northern Ireland] or the Secretary of State is requested to make enquiries about a child under Article 15(1)(b) of the Convention he may—

(a)request a local authority or [F2an officer of the Service][F3or a Welsh family proceedings officer] to make a report to him in writing with respect to any matter relating to the child concerned which appears to him to be relevant;

(b)request the Department of Health and Social Services for Northern Ireland to arrange for a suitably qualified person to make such a report to him;

(c)request any court to which a written report relating to the child has been made to send him a copy of the report;

and any such request shall be duly complied with.
